This movie counts the second time Helena Bonham Carter and Rupert Graves have played sister and brother. They previously portrayed siblings 'Lucy and Freddy Honeychurch' in 'A Room with a View'(1986). suite

This defines droll., 25 September 2000
8/10
Author: ktmphd (ktmphd@webtv.net) de Bay City, MI

If you want to know what people mean when they say the British are superb in creating droll comedies and you do not know what they are talking about, watch this movie! You also get the benefit of seeing a movie that gives new meanings to words like ironic, satiric, quaint, bucolic, whimsical and hilarious.

The three leads are superb, but watch for the secondary leads, such as the boss who gets the axe by his wife due to his being set up, or the husband who gets shot by accident and everyone is ecstatic or, best of all, the head housekeeper who is taking two or three years to break in her replacement.

Get it, rent it, do whatever you need to do to see it and laugh. Then sit around as I am with impatience waiting for the sequel.
